How correlated are ASA and DGP?

Across a 3-year window, the weekly returns of ASA and DGP correlate at 0.82, very strong, meaning they move nearly in lockstep. Recent behaviour matches the longer record: 0.87 over 1 year against 0.82 over 3. Stretching to 5 years gives 0.80, with an annualized covariance of 1298.5 %².

By 3-year correlation, DGP places #9 of the 59 assets tracked against ASA. Their recent paths diverged sharply: over the last 12 months ASA outperformed by 15.1 percentage points (+77.0% for ASA against +61.9% for DGP).

How is this computed?

Pearson correlation on weekly returns: ρ(A,B) = cov(rA, rB) / (σA · σB), over windows of 52, 156 and 260 weeks. Covariance is annualized (×52) and expressed in %². Full definitions on the methodology page.

What does a correlation of 0.82 mean?

A reading of 0.82 sits on a scale from −1 (opposite moves) through 0 (unrelated) to +1 (identical moves). Correlation captures direction, not magnitude or performance.
